翻譯|使用教程|編輯:凌霄漢|2022-04-13 17:21:37.933|閱讀 415 次
概述:本篇文章為大家帶來報表開發工具FastReport.NET使用教程:如何在 FastReport .NET 的 RichText 編輯器中使用標尺。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
RichText 編輯器中添加了標尺。它允許用戶控制標簽寬度并在左右邊距之前設置縮進。
添加制表位需要在水平標尺需要的地方雙擊鼠標左鍵。所選區域中將出現一個“箭頭”,指示制表位。當在這個“箭頭”上按住鼠標左鍵時,你可以通過移動鼠標來改變它的位置。同時,在按下并移動“箭頭”的同時,會顯示一個指南,清楚地顯示出表格后文本的未來位置。
標尺上給定制表位的示例:
如果不需要該選項卡,您可以通過右鍵單擊它來刪除它。
您可以通過將鼠標懸停在與縮進相對應的標尺末端來設置縮進。這會將光標從主模式更改為水平調整大小模式。只需按住左鍵即可更改它們。
更改左縮進時,文本的初始位置會發生變化,并且已經設置的制表位相對于該縮進的位置也會發生變化。更改右縮進時,將設置文本換行位置。值得注意的是,如果文本字段的尺寸發生變化,右縮進的位置將相對于文本字段的右邊緣發生變化。
沒有縮進的富文本示例:
具有左右縮進的富文本示例:
還值得注意的是,使用標尺對整個文本及其部分進行格式化。如果 RichObject 在開始編輯時為空,則指定的格式將在寫入時應用于所有文本。這將一直發生,直到用鼠標將光標移動到任何一行或選擇了文本的某些部分。在 RichObject 不為空的情況下,開始編輯的標尺將顯示第一行的格式。
如果要對文本的一部分應用格式,則選擇必要的部分,然后所選部分的格式將顯示在標尺上。這部分在 2 種情況下將是“干凈的”:
更改具有不同格式的文本時,舊格式將被新格式替換。使用標尺選擇所有文本進行格式化是一種特殊情況,因此在對標尺進行任何操作后將立即刪除文本選擇。此外,對于已存在或將要寫入的所有文本,選擇將消失,并且將應用當前設置的格式。
通過增強設計器中的 RichText 編輯器并減少用戶在創建富文本時使用第三方文本編輯器的需要,此更改應該使報告更容易。
FastReport 技術交流群:702295239 歡迎一起進群討論
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n